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port (CDG)
CDG is about 26 kilometres from central Paris. If you're catching a taxi, ride-sharing or driving from the centre, it'll take you 35 minutes or so to get there, depending on traffic conditions. If you're taking public transport, expect the journey time to be around 35 minutes.

Paris Beauvais-Tille Airport (BVA)
BVA is roughly 88 kilometres from central Paris. Driving from the city centre to the terminal takes about 1 hour 15 minutes. If you're thinking about using public transport, expect a journey of around 1 hour 15 minutes.

Getting from Perpignan-Rivesaltes Airport (PGF) to central Perpignan
Central Perpignan is around 13 kilometres from Perpignan-Rivesaltes Airport and takes about 20 minutes to reach by car. See what your options are for making the trip into the city, whether that's with a taxi, car hire or ride-share.
Travelling on public transport takes roughly 30 minutes.

The best time to fly from Paris to Perpignan-Rivesaltes Airport (PGF)
February is the quietest month for flights from Paris to Perpignan-Rivesaltes Airport (PGF), while July is the busiest. Figure out the ideal time to go to Perpignan based on whether you like a laid-back vibe or a more bustling atmosphere.
Lock in a Paris to PGF plane ticket departing in July if you're eager to explore the city during its warmest month. Expect temperatures in Perpignan to range from 17ºC to 33ºC.
If you'd rather travel in c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from Paris to Perpignan-Rivesaltes Airport in January when temperatures are between 2ºC and 13ºC.
